The Greenfield-Central Cougars will challenge the Franklin Community Grizzly Cubs at 6:00 p.m. on Friday. Both teams are coming into the matchup red-hot, with Greenfield-Central sitting on three straight wins and Franklin Community on four.

Greenfield-Central had to skate by with only a two-run margin when they last took the field, which might have inspired the six-run drubbing they dealt Columbus East on Thursday. The Cougars were the clear victors by an 8-2 margin over the Olympians. That looming 8-2 mark stands out as the most commanding margin for the Cougars yet this season.

Addie Heacox sp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ered just two earned runs on ten hits. She has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't given up more than two walks in four consecutive appearances.

On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Kristen Wineinger, who went 1-for-4 with one home run and four RBI.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in April of 2024. Charlotte Riehle was another key player, going 3-for-4 with two doubles and two RBI.

Meanwhile, Franklin Community made easy work of Perry Meridian on Wednesday and carried off a 14-1 victory. The Grizzly Cubs might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won four contests by seven runs or more this season.

Annabelle Richter made a big impact while hitting and pitching. She pitched five innings while giving up just one earned run off six hits. Richter was also big at the plate, going 2-for-3 with one stolen base, one double, and one RBI.

In other batting news, Franklin Community got a massive performance out of Aubrey Leugers, who went a perfect 1-for-1 with one home run, four RBI, and two runs. Another player making a difference was Adeline Blackwell,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with four stolen bases and three runs.

Franklin Community hit smart and finished the game with only two strikeouts. They are a perfect 3-0 when they post two or more strikeouts.

Franklin Community's win was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 4-2. Those road vict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 13.3 runs over those games. As for Greenfield-Central, their win bumped their record up to 4-2.

Fans could be in store for some top-tier slugging on Friday. Greenfield-Central hasn't had any problems when it comes to power this season, having averaged 0.5 home runs per game. However, it's not like Franklin Community struggles in that department as they've been averaging an even more impressive 1 home runs. With so much power on both teams, it'll be down to the pitchers to keep the mound locked down.

Greenfield-Central took their victory against Franklin Community when the teams last played back in April of 2024 by a conclusive 15-4 score. Will the Cougars repeat their success, or do the Grizzly Cubs have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
